Tracklist
|
A1 | Push Push | 9:55 | A2 | What's Going On | 4:12 | A3 | Spirit In The Dark | 9:25 | B1 | Man's Hope | 6:54 | B2 | If | 4:29 | B3 | Never Can Say Goodbye | 3:32 | B4 | What'd I Say | 4:55 |
|
Identifiers
Matrix / RunoutSide One: SD-532-S1 Q W Matrix / RunoutSide Two: SD-532-S2 Q W Pressing Plant IDIn runouts: Q
Credits Artwork - Paula Bisacca Bass - Chuck Rainey (Tracks: A1, A2, B3), Donald "Duck" Dunn (Tracks: B1, B2), Jerry Jemmott (Tracks: A3, B4) Drums - Al Jackson Jr. (Tracks: B1, B2), Bernard Purdie (Tracks: A1 to A3, B3, B4) Electric Piano - Richard Tee Engineer - Jimmy Douglass Engineer [Remix] - Arif Mardin Flute - Herbie Mann Flute [Alto] - Herbie Mann (Tracks: A1, A2, B1 to B3) Guitar - Cornell Dupree (Tracks: A1, A2, B3), David Spinozza (Tracks: A3, B1, B2, B4), Duane Allman Harp - Gene Bianco (Tracks: A1, B3) Organ - Richard Tee (Tracks: A1, A2, B3) Percussion - Ralph MacDonald Photography - Joel Brodsky Piano - Richard Tee (Tracks: A1, A2, B1 to B3) Producer - Arif Mardin
Notes This release is a variation with red Cotillion labels
Side A is listed on sleeve as "Side One" & Side B as "Side A"
Die-cut front sleeve exposing felt relief sticker inside gatefold with scene depicting some Push Pushing.
Arrangement on B1 based on "Hatikvah" by Herbie Mann.
